inhabited

US/ɪn'hæbɪtɪd/
UK/ɪnˈhæbɪtɪd/

adj. 有人居住的

v. 居住于,栖居于( inhabit的过去式和过去分词 )

inhabited柯林斯释义

VERB居住于;栖居在

If a place or region is inhabited by a group of people or a species of animal, those people or animals live there.

  • The valley is inhabited by the Dani tribe.

    山谷里居住着达尼部落。

  • ...the people who inhabit these islands.

    居住在这些岛上的人们

inhabited英文释义

Adjective

1. having inhabitants; lived in;

  • the inhabited regions of the earth
